Power Platform, SharePoint, Azure and Dot .Net Developer Job duties:

  • Experienced Power Platform (Power App and Power Automate) Senior Developer who can design, build and support ever-growing automation requirements across the units.
  • Good Knowledge and Experience in Power Platform Environments, Power Platform License, Dataverse, other 3rd party Data Sources (non -CDS), Connectors, DLP Policies, Power Platform Core Framework, Reusable components, Security Roles, etc.
  • Strong hands-on experience in developing enterprise applications using Microsoft .NET framework, SharePoint, C#, Power Apps, Power Platform, O365, and related Azure technologies.
  • Good understanding of Azure platform capabilities, including Functions, Logic Apps, Azure Service Bus, and Modern Authentication.
  • Prior experience of implementing Power Platform DevSecOps using Pipelines, ALM Accelerator, DevOps/Github Design and implementation of CI/CD pipelines.
  • Knowledge of security processes and security controls.
  • Excellent grasp and knowledge of industry best practices in the Dynamics 365 domain, with a successful track record of implementing projects in complex IT and business environments.
  • Actively seeks and shares knowledge with others, effectively communicating and presenting information in a clear and organized manner.
  • Organized, agile, persistent, and proactive, with the ability to juggle multiple tasks within tight deadlines.
  • Delivers information effectively to support the team or workgroup, with strong writing and editing skills in English, conveying complex ideas clearly and directly.
  • Hands-on experience in developing Power Automate to support Backend jobs, bulk updates to Dataverse, connection to SharePoint, 0365. Etc.
  • Thoroughly document and effectively communicate technical analyses, designs, and specifications. Additionally, provide explanations for the preferred approach over alternative solutions.
  • 5+ years of relevant experience and 10+ years of overall experience is desired.
  • Proven ability to collaborate with team members across boundaries, contributing productively and respecting different points of view. Able to cultivate effective client relationships and partnerships across organizational boundaries.
  • Takes personal ownership and accountability for meeting deadlines and achieving agreed-upon results, with strong problem-solving skills.
  • Experience working with Azure DevOps and continuous integration.
  • Familiarity with Agile software delivery methodologies such as Scrum.

Dexian is a leading provider of staffing, IT, and workforce solutions with over 12,000 employees and 70 locations worldwide. As one of the largest IT staffing companies and the 2nd largest minority-owned staffing company in the U.S., Dexian was formed in 2023 through the merger of DISYS and Signature Consultants. Combining the best elements of its core companies, Dexian’s platform connects talent, technology, and organizations to produce game-changing results that help everyone achieve their ambitions and goals.

Dexian’s brands include Dexian DISYS, Dexian Signature Consultants, Dexian Government Solutions, Dexian Talent Development and Dexian IT Solutions. Visit https://dexian.com/ to learn more.
